A Tactical Overview of the Match
The match began with Manchester City asserting their dominance early on. Their high-pressing strategy and quick transitions caught Chelsea off guard, leading to an early goal by Erling Haaland in the 14th minute.
The Norwegian striker, who has been in prolific form, latched onto a precise pass from Kevin De Bruyne, showcasing his lethal finishing ability.
Chelsea, on the other hand, struggled to find their rhythm. Despite having a solid defensive structure, they found it difficult to break City's pressing lines.
Maresca's decision to play a more conservative midfield setup was aimed at containing City's attacking threat, but it inadvertently stifled Chelsea's creativity going forward.
As a result, the Blues managed only a few shots on target, all of which were comfortably dealt with by City's goalkeeper, Ederson.
City's second goal came in the 68th minute, courtesy of Phil Foden. The young Englishman displayed his technical prowess by cutting inside from the left flank and curling a shot into the far corner, leaving Chelsea's defense flat-footed.
This goal effectively sealed the game, as Chelsea failed to mount a significant comeback in the remaining minutes.
Maresca's Post-Match Reaction
In his post-match interview, Enzo Maresca was candid about Chelsea's shortcomings. He acknowledged Manchester City's superiority on the day, particularly in terms of their tactical execution and individual brilliance.
Maresca highlighted the need for Chelsea to be more proactive in such high-stakes matches, emphasizing the importance of maintaining possession and creating more goal-scoring opportunities.
"We knew it was going to be a tough match against one of the best teams in Europe," Maresca said.
"But I think we could have done better, especially in the final third. We need to work on our decision-making and ensure that we are more clinical when chances arise.
City punished us for our mistakes, and at this level, you can't afford to be anything less than perfect."
Maresca also praised his players for their effort and resilience, despite the disappointing result.
He noted that the team is still in the process of adapting to his tactical philosophy, and that there will be ups and downs along the way.
However, he remained optimistic about Chelsea's future prospects, stating that the defeat would serve as a valuable learning experience.
"We're still building something here," Maresca continued. "It's a process, and there will be setbacks.
But I believe in this group of players, and I have no doubt that we will come back stronger. It's important to stay focused and keep working hard."
Key Takeaways from the Match
1. City's Tactical Masterclass:
Pep Guardiola's team once again demonstrated why they are among the elite clubs in world football. Their ability to control the game, both with and without the ball, was a testament to their tactical discipline and understanding.
2. Chelsea's Struggles in Attack:
Chelsea's inability to break down City's defense was a major concern. The lack of creativity and fluidity in their attacking play highlighted the need for Maresca to find a solution to unlock tight defenses.
3. Maresca's Tactical Adjustments:
While Maresca's defensive setup aimed to neutralize City's threats, it came at the cost of Chelsea's attacking potency. Finding the right balance between defense and attack will be crucial for Chelsea moving forward.
4. The Importance of Squad Depth:
With key players missing due to injuries, Chelsea's lack of depth was evident. Reinforcements in the January transfer window could be necessary to strengthen the squad for the remainder of the season.
